If you need to acquire a credit card, though you lack a lengthy credit history, think about getting someone to co-sign your application. A family member or close friend with good credit can co-sign for you. Your co-signer will be legally obligated to make payments on your balance if you either do not or cannot make a payment. This is one method that is effective in helping individuals to obtain their first card so that they can start building credit.

Understand the recent developments in credit card law. Retroactive rate increases are illegal, for example. Double-cycle billing is also forbidden. Research the law. There have been two major changes in the laws. You should read up on them to familiarize yourself.

TIP! Avoid prepaid cards at all costs when looking for cards. In reality, they are debit cards and don’t send reports to credit bureaus that might help improve your record.

If you are searching for cards that are secured, steer clear of prepaid cards. In reality they are debit cards, which means they don’t report to any major credit agencies. These cards often have hidden fees, and act more like a checking account than a credit card. Make a deposit to get a secured credit card which reports to credit bureaus and can improve your credit rating.
